Koroška hiša and the Guesthouse Gora pod lipo. Each on its side of the Pohorje mountain range, both created with the wish to preserve the roots, tradition and characteristics of the local environment. Both have their own story and gastronomy adding value to the region. In the yards of both houses stands a linden tree – the symbol of Slovenia.
The homestead Koroška hiša fascinates with its selection of local dishes that are presented in an original way. You will be accommodated in a štiblc with its special charm. Nearby is one of the oldest churches in Slovenia – the rotunda of John the Baptist. Having breakfast is a special experience in the Koroška hiša and you will also be served coffee or tea in lovely cups – as well as something sweet. In the middle of Helena’s garden is an event you will never forget. Koroška hiša is also an excellent starting point for bicycle tours along the colourful valley Dravska dolina.
On the hillside of Pohorje, among the vineyards, is the homestead Gora pod lipo. When breathing the fresh air of the Pohorje mountain, tasting the meals and feeling the warmth of the homestead, it feels as if time stands still for a moment. Chef Andrej Kuhar ads a touch of high cuisine to the regional culinary story. All this is complemented by house wines, produced on the basis of their own local yeast. In the cold months the smell of an open fire spreads through the old house. This is the time when you can, for a moment, feel like in the times of your grandparents. During summer you can enjoy the quiet nature and relax in the sun.
A former Slovenian slogan said – we the people are tourism. And we feel the same. All of us, who co-create the story tastes of Pohorje. During your welcome you will feel the personal touch. The soul is captured in the ambience of both our houses, telling the story of our region. The most important thing for us is the food that is prepared with love and selected ingredients.
On your way through the beautiful valley Dravska dolina towards Bistrica Pohorje do not miss visiting the oldest vine in the world. It is over 400 years old. In the house Stara trta you can taste wines of the Styrian region and learn more about their history.

Package itinerary
Day 1:
15.00: arrival at the homestead Koroška hiša na Muti, accommodation in a štiblc;
15.30: Koroški javzn (a Corinthian snack); buckwheat porridge and mushroom soup
16.15: a visit to the rotunda – the oldest church in Slovenia
17.30: adventures on snow: a ride with a pležuh or cycling with old bikes along the bicycle route to the Reš pond and exploring the
learning path Dobrava along the Drava river (depending on the time of year)
19.00: dinner with dishes of the story (wishing table) in Koroška hiša
Overnight stay in a štiblc in Koroška hiša
Day 2:
8.00: breakfast
9.30 departure for Maribor
11.00 arrival to and visit of the oldest vine in the world (Hiša Stare trte); wine tasting (three different wines) and a presentation of the vine’s history
12.15 departure for Tinjska Gora to the homestead Gora pod lipo
13.00 Arrival and welcome by the family of Gora pod lipo
Culinary experience with chef Andrej Kuhar, accompanied by house wines that you will be able to taste in the heart of the
homestead – the wine cellar
